Kvarnkasetjärnet
Character of the water
Kvarnkasetjärnet lies in the south — a southern humic brown forest lake. The tea-stained, humic water hides the bottom within an arm's length.
The surroundings
The lake lies half-remote, a fair way from the nearest road, tucked into woodland.
A small but surprisingly deep pocket (15 m) with steep drops straight down from shore — the bottom falls away fast.
Permits & rules
Fishing permit required — Kvarnkasetjärnet FVOF. Day permit ~100 kr · annual permit ~500 kr.
- Pike: keep at most one over 75 cm per day.
-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.
